Transaction fe6d714ff0278dad3033e366e3e0c19f109af3ebf291674349f5f36222b85990
2 Input
2 Outputs
- fe6d714ff0278dad3033e366e3e0c19f109af3ebf291674349f5f36222b85990:0
- fe6d714ff0278dad3033e366e3e0c19f109af3ebf291674349f5f36222b85990:1
value 1044084
address 166BteDBb63f3ZahfuWUsPhsusa8biV7Nd
value 6868478
address 3GDjeSUQe6okcE5R1gNN5wSEsUpfzX1pTs